Cutshort logo
Mool logo
Backend Engineer (Golang)
at Mool
Backend Engineer (Golang)
Mool's logo

Backend Engineer (Golang)

Ritikaa TL's profile picture
Posted by Ritikaa TL
2 - 15 yrs
₹8L - ₹40L / yr
Delhi, Gurugram, Noida, Ghaziabad, Faridabad
Skills
skill iconGo Programming (Golang)
RESTful APIs
API management
Microservices
skill iconJavascript
MVC Framework
Relational Database (RDBMS)

About the role: In this role, you will be responsible for the end-to-end development of software solutions related to banking, payments, investments, wallets, and other fintech products. You will work closely with software engineers, test engineers, researchers, designers, and the management team.

You will be responsible for enforcing software development best practices in a fast-paced Agile/DevOps environment, while always focusing on delivering high-value. In the process, you will work with primarily fintech technologies and other distributed systems-related tools,
techniques and methodologies.

If you want to join an early-stage startup that values you and your skills, and gives you the freedom to work at your pace while delivering a fantastic all-in-one financial app for all Indians, this is the perfect role for you.


About us: Mool is an all-in-one financial app where you can save, spend and invest your money with confidence. We understand that everyone deserves a good relationship with their money and growing your wealth should not be a difficult process. To help you gain financial freedom, we bring together champions of the financial service industry to champion you with best-in-class products.

Our ideal candidates will:
• Be highly experienced in Golang. So, if you have at least 1 year of active golang development experience, we want you!
• Have a good understanding of the MVC framework and also proficiency in using advanced JavaScript libraries and frameworks such as ExpressJS, FastifyJS and other backend and frontend frameworks
• Understand and experience with cloud technologies: AWS (Must have) and Azure.
• Be knowledgeable in code versioning tools and dev ops methodologies such as Git.
• Highly experienced with various databases such as MongoDB, PostgreSQL, MYSQL
• Have worked on Relational Database and can figure out where to add Indexes in DB to optimise the performance
• Know how Cache Layer works (e.g. Redis)
• Have experience with queuing services and frameworks such as KafkaRabbit MQ. We prefer it if you have experience with fintech systems and applications
• Expected to have a good understanding of security practices for financial systems.
• Have experience in writing Unit and E2E test cases
• Have experience with Network Security or Ethical Hacking
• Experience with integrating banking APIs

Roles and responsibilities:
• Take an active part in the design process of the architecture of the mobile application
• Maintain quality and ensure responsiveness of applications
• Collaborate with the rest of the engineering team to design and launch new features
• Maintain code integrity and organization
• Working with the design team to convert designs to visual elements
• Implement security and data protection systems and processes to ensure information security compliance
• Oversee full software development lifecycle for the product

Read more
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os

About Mool

Founded :
2020
Type :
Product
Size :
20-100
Stage :
Raised funding

About

One app to save, spend, and invest with confidence.

Read more

Tech stack

GoLang
skill iconPostgreSQL
skill iconNodeJS (Node.js)
skill iconReact.js
skill iconFlutter

Company social profiles

instagramlinkedintwitterfacebook

Similar jobs

Wissen Technology
at Wissen Technology
4 recruiters
Tony Tom
Posted by Tony Tom
Bengaluru (Bangalore)
2 - 10 yrs
Best in industry
skill iconJava
06692
Microservices
Multithreading
Algorithms
+1 more
  • Experience in Core Java, CXF, Spring.
  • Experience in spring boot, microservices.
  • Extensive experience in developing enterprise-scale n-tier applications for the financial domain. Should possess good architectural knowledge and be aware of enterprise application design patterns.
  • Should have the ability to analyze, design, develop and test complex, low-latency client-facing applications.
  • Good development experience with RDBMS, preferably Sybase database
  • Good knowledge of multi-threading and high volume server side development
  • Experience in sales and trading platforms in investment banking/capital markets
  • Basic working knowledge of Unix/Linux
  • Excellent problem solving and coding skills in Java
  • Strong interpersonal, communication and analytical skills.
  • Should have the ability to express their design ideas and thoughts.


Read more
ZeMoSo Technologies
at ZeMoSo Technologies
11 recruiters
HR Team
Posted by HR Team
Remote only
6 - 12 yrs
₹8L - ₹18L / yr
skill iconJava
06692
skill iconSpring Boot
Hibernate (Java)
Microservices

·What You will do


● Create beautiful software experiences for our clients using design thinking, lean and agile methodology.

● Work on world-class software products using the latest cutting edge technologies and platforms.

● Work in a dynamic, collaborative, transparent, non-hierarchical culture.

● Work in collaborative, fast-paced and value-driven teams to build innovative customer experiences for our clients.

● Help to grow the next generation of developers and have a positive impact on the industry.


Basic Qualifications


● Experience: 4+ years.

● Hands-on development experience in backend, Java, SprintBoot, Hibernate, SQL, MongoDB, Jenkins, Microservices etc...

● Server-side development experience mainly in JAVA.

● Passion for software engineering and follow the best coding concepts. ● Good to great problem solving and communication skills.

● Experience in working with cross-border, distributed teams is a must.


Nice to have Qualifications


● Product and customer-centric mindset.

● Great OO skills, including design patterns.

● Experience with large-scale enterprise systems

Read more
InnovationM
at InnovationM
2 recruiters
Nandita Naithani
Posted by Nandita Naithani
Noida
4 - 7 yrs
₹1L - ₹17L / yr
skill iconJava
J2EE
skill iconSpring Boot
Hibernate (Java)
RESTful APIs
+5 more


InnovationM is looking for a Java Developer with experience in Spring Boot, Microservices, and MongoDB to join our team. The ideal candidate should have hands-on experience in designing and developing REST APIs using Spring Boot, building microservices-based applications, working with MongoDB and have experience in deploying applications in AWS.


What you must be good at:

● Develop and maintain REST APIs using Spring Boot framework

● Build microservices-based applications using Spring Boot and related frameworks

● Design and develop data models and queries for MongoDB database

● Deploy applications in AWS using EC2, ECR, and other relevant AWS services

● Work in an Agile development environment

● Collaborate with cross-functional teams to deliver high-quality software


What you must be good at:

● 4+ years of experience in Java development

● Strong experience in Spring Boot and related frameworks

● Hands-on experience in building microservices-based applications

● Proficient in designing and developing REST APIs

● Strong experience in MongoDB, including data modeling and query optimization

● Good understanding of AWS services and deployment methodologies

● Experience working in an Agile development environment

● Proficient in Git and version control systems

Read more
data beat
data beat
Agency job
via Aptita Consulting Partners by deepika sethiya
Hyderabad
1 - 3 yrs
₹2L - ₹5L / yr
skill icon.NET
ASP.NET
skill iconC#
MVC Framework
Web API
+1 more
Responsibilities:
- Microsoft development experience using C#, ASP.NET Core Web API, MVC, Authentication and
Authorization, and proficient in developing large scale web applications using a .Net framework.
- Hands-on working experience with setting up applications using Azure Functions, Azure SQL and
NoSQL
- Guide the development team with building applications on Azure Cloud
- Learn and research new solutions for application development that can be applicable to the
business problems we solve
Requirements:
- Problem solver using data and deep understanding of designing/setting up solutions
- Minimum of 2 years experience using and implementing Azure Active Directory, Azure Functions
with various triggers
- Strong interpersonal and communication skills and flexibility to work US Hours if needed
- Be flexible to learn new technologies and apply them to solve business problems
- Strong Communication skills (verbal and written).
- Extremely detail-oriented and well-organized.
- Ability to positively engage with the clients and build strong long-term relationships.
- Ability to work efficiently and effectively in a high-paced environment and under deadlines.
About Us:
DataBeat.io is a data and analytics services company that provides big data, analytics and
operations management services to various companies globally.
Working at DataBeat.io helps you to be at the forefront of the big data and analytics ecosystem. You
will work with clients who are leading companies that develop breakthrough solutions, concepts that
are shaping the technology world and cutting-edge tools. Fast-growing company where your
performance and contribution could move you into leadership positions fairly quickly.
Read more
Publicis Sapient
at Publicis Sapient
10 recruiters
Kanchan Lalwani
Posted by Kanchan Lalwani
Gurugram, Noida, Bengaluru (Bangalore), Pune, Mumbai, Hyderabad
5 - 18 yrs
₹10L - ₹15L / yr
Microservices
RESTful APIs
skill iconAmazon Web Services (AWS)
SOLID
AWS Lambda
+15 more
Your Skills & Experience:

  • 5+ years of software development experience in Java 8+ and Microservices.
  • Experience in developing micro services. Experience in developing High Cohesion & Loosely Coupled Micro Services.
  • Experienced in skills of requirement, analysis, design, develop, Java, springboot, microservices, rest api, AWS, lambda, EC2, Jenkins, design pattern, spring security, splunk, auth, docker, SOLID
  • Hands on experience on Microservices Architecture.
  • Should have excellent acumen in Data Structures, algorithms, problem-solving and Logical/Analytical skills. Thorough understanding of OOPS concepts, Design principles and implementation of different type of Design patterns.
  • Experience with Multithreading, Concurrent Package and Concurrent APIs
  • Basic understanding of Java Memory Management (JMM) including garbage collections concepts.
  • Experience in RDBMS or NO SQL databases and writing SQL queries (Joins, group by, aggregate functions, etc.)
  • Hands-on experience with Message Broker like Kafka/Rabbitmq or other. Hands-on experience in creating RESTful webservices and consuming web services. Hands-on experience with spring Cloud/Spring Boot.
  • Hands-on experience with any of the logging frameworks (SLF4J/LogBack/Log4j)
  • Experience of writing Junit test cases using Mockito / Powermock frameworks. Should have practical experience with Maven/Gradle and knowledge of version control systems like Git/SVN etc.
  • Hands on experience on Cloud deployment/development like AWS/Azure/GCP.
  • Good communication skills and ability to work with global teams to define and deliver on projects. Sound understanding/experience in software development process, test-driven development.


Benefits of Working Here:

  • Gender Neutral /Diversified Culture
  • 51 Leaves annually
  • Insurance covered for family
  • Incentives, Bonus
  • Permanent WFH Option
  • Generous parental leave and new parent transition program
  • Flexible work arrangements
Read more
Global Banking Client
Global Banking Client
Agency job
Pune
12 - 17 yrs
₹46L - ₹48L / yr
skill iconJava
skill iconSpring Boot
Microservices

The Solution Architect plays a critical role in the architecture design and development of globally consistent Liquidity and Cash Management solutions and is a key contributor to the overall delivery in a fast-paced and challenging environment.

Responsibilities:

  • Develops technology road maps, while keeping up-to-date with emerging technologies, and recommends business directions based on these technologies
  • Provides technical leadership and is responsible for developing components of, or the overall systems design.
  • Translates complex business problems into sound technical solutions.
  • Provides integrated systems planning and recommends innovative technologies that will enhance the current system.
  • Contribute to ongoing architecture governance and reviewing proposed solutions.
  • Lead integration of new and existing components with ICG Platforms.


Qualifications:

  • 10+ years relevant experience
  • Experience as Full-Stack Developer and Experience as Architect Desired
  • Understanding of integration technologies concepts like Webservices, REST API etc
  • Familiar with DevOps tools like Maven, Jenkins, Bitbucket etc
  • Consistently demonstrates clear and concise written and verbal communication
  • Management and prioritization skills
  • Ability to develop working relationships
  • Ability to manage multiple activities and changing priorities
  •  


Education:

  • Bachelor’s/University degree or equivalent experience, potentially Masters degree

 

 

 

Read more
BotCart
at BotCart
3 recruiters
Akhil Varyani
Posted by Akhil Varyani
Remote only
0 - 5 yrs
₹3L - ₹6L / yr
skill iconRuby
skill iconRuby on Rails (ROR)
skill iconJavascript
skill iconAngularJS (1.x)
skill iconAngular (2+)
+1 more

This is a temporary full time/freelancer role.

 

Requirements: 

  • - Write well designed, testable code in popular Javascript frameworks like React, Angular etc. and Ruby/Ruby on Rails.
    - A good exposure to both SQL and NoSQL database architectures.
  • - Ability to write well documented and testable scripts to automate some processes, preferably using Javascript and/or Ruby.
  • - A strong problem solving mindset.
  • - Excellent oral and written communication skills.
    - Ability to work collaboratively in teams, with a self-starting, entrepreneurial and ownership mindset.
  • - Experience working on Open Source projects is a big plus

 

Responsibilities:               

 

  • - You will be responsible to work on key issues for one of our dashboard platforms, and collaborate with other developers and the product team to drive the product development forward.
  • - You will be expected to take ownership of the work you do, and the dashboard platform that you will be working on.
  • - You will be also responsible to train future developers on the platform you'll be working on, once they join your team.
  • - At times you will be required to communicate and collaborate with our dashboard implementation partners on a technical front, to discuss roadblocks, potential future roadmaps and improvements, along with our engineering and product teams.
  • - You will be required to attend weekly cadences with the team to discuss updates and future goals, brainstorm on some problems and give key updates on deliverables on behalf of the team you'll be working with.
Read more
Cogentec IT Solutions
at Cogentec IT Solutions
4 recruiters
Sangeeta Salam
Posted by Sangeeta Salam
Bengaluru (Bangalore)
1 - 4 yrs
₹4L - ₹6L / yr
skill icon.NET
skill iconjQuery
MVC Framework
Web Development
Full stack Dot net Developer with ability to learn.
Read more
StarTele Logic
at StarTele Logic
1 recruiter
Hariom Tiwari
Posted by Hariom Tiwari
NCR (Delhi | Gurgaon | Noida)
1 - 3 yrs
₹5L - ₹7L / yr
skill iconGo Programming (Golang)
skill iconPython
FreeSWITCH
skill iconPostgreSQL
skill iconRedis
+4 more
RESPONSIBILITIES Evaluate technologies and development stacks for API based platform which scales to build largest CPaaS Own end to end life cycle of the product from requirement analysis, design, development, test, release and maintenance. Develop reusable tools/libraries Continuously improve cycle time, throughput, and code quality. Continuously improve value-adding-activities/non-value-adding activities ratio. SKILLS REQUIRED 1 - 3 years of experience Must have worked on any one or more : Golang, Django, Flask, Redis, memcache, Postgres, Celery, DynamoDB, Nginx, Linux, Git, AWS, Docker Proficient in at-least one OO language: Python/Golang(preferred) Writing high-performance, reliable and maintainable code. Excellent microservices pattern understanding. Ability to define cross core contracts and bring them to closure through collaboration. Good knowledge of database structures, theories, principles, and practices. Experience working with AWS components [EC2, S3, SNS, SQS] Analytical and problem solving skills Good aptitude in multi-threading and concurrency concepts. Working knowledge of Git and proficiency with at-least one build server: Jenkins / Travis / Bamboo Experience in Telecom domain is a plus
Read more
Mintifi
at Mintifi
3 recruiters
Suchita Upadhyay
Posted by Suchita Upadhyay
Mumbai
2 - 6 yrs
₹8L - ₹12L / yr
skill iconRuby on Rails (ROR)
Algorithms
skill iconJavascript
skill iconjQuery
Job Title: Software Developer-Ruby on Rails Responsibilities We are looking for a Developer who can drive innovation and take ownership and deliver results. • Build & own Mintifi product and technology platform • Be heavily involved in every step of the product development process, from ideation to implementation to release. • Design and build systems with automated instrumentation and monitoring • Write unit & integration tests, participate in manual testing and maintain backend components (application, data, infrastructure, analytics and deployment) • Ability to thrive in a dynamic, fast-paced, collaborative, and high-growth start-up environment • Great, innovative problem solver who can turn ambiguous problem spaces into clear design solutions. Qualifications • Excellent programming skills Ruby on Rails • Good understanding about Data Structures and Algorithms • Good understanding about relational and non-relational database concepts (MySQL, Hadoop, MongoDB) • Exposure to front-end technologies like HTML, CSS, Javascript as well as JS libraries/frameworks like JQuery, Angular, Ember, D3, etc. is a strong plus. • Basic knowledge of Windows and Unix system administration Compensation Best in the industry Job Location: Mumbai
Read more
Why apply to jobs via Cutshort
people_solving_puzzle
Personalized job matches
Stop wasting time. Get matched with jobs that meet your skills, aspirations and preferences.
people_verifying_people
Verified hiring teams
See actual hiring teams, find common social connections or connect with them directly.
ai_chip
Move faster with AI
We use AI to get you faster responses, recommendations and unmatched user experience.
Did not find a job you were looking for?
icon
Search for relevant jobs from 10000+ companies such as Google, Amazon & Uber actively hiring on Cutshort.
companies logo
companies logo
companies logo
companies logo
companies logo
Get to hear about interesting companies hiring right now
Company logo
Company logo
Company logo
Company logo
Company logo
Linkedin iconFollow Cutshort
Users love Cutshort
Read about what our users have to say about finding their next opportunity on Cutshort.
Shubham Vishwakarma's profile image

Shubham Vishwakarma

Full Stack Developer - Averlon
I had an amazing experience. It was a delight getting interviewed via Cutshort. The entire end to end process was amazing. I would like to mention Reshika, she was just amazing wrt guiding me through the process. Thank you team.
Companies hiring on Cutshort
companies logos